Following Compline

St. Mark's Cathedral has a D.A. Flentrop organ built in Holland in 1965. The organ boasts58 stops, 79 ranks and 3,944 pipes. The larger pipes look like industrial smoke stacks. The resonance is deep. In contrast, the kid's music system in the car next to me at the stop light with the boom, boom base vibrations coming forth from the back seat and all the windows rolled down sound like a plastic toy whistle on mute.
